摘要
A one pot reaction of MnCl2, acetylene dicarboxylate (C4O42-), and 1,2-bis(4-pyridyl)ethane (bpe) leads to a compound formulated as [{Mn(bpe)(H2O)(4)}C4O4)-4.5H(2)O] and has been shown by single crystal structure analysis to be a three-dimensional network with hexagonal and rhombohedral channels encapsulating C(4)O(4)2- and water molecules, constructed by the one-dimensional "sinusoidal" [Mn(bpe)(H2O)(4)](n)(2+) cationic chains through extensive hydrogen-bonding and pi-pi interactions.
